Natural Resources Not Enough for Development

As Ghana prepares for commercial production of oil by the year 2011 with high expectation of economic prosperity, members of the public have been advised to rather focus more on attitudinal change and a change of negative mentality.

The Director of the West Africa Office of Samaritan Strategy Mr. Christopher Ampadu gave the advise in Accra. He said abundant natural resources such as timber, gold, diamond and manganese among other resources are economically beneficial to a country. He however observed that the economic impact of such natural resources cannot be fully felt if public officials and the entire public do not change their negative habits and mentality.

Mr. Christopher Ampadu was speaking to Peace FM in an interview at the 2009 National Vision Conference of Samaritan Strategy in Accra. The 5-day conference is being attended by Church leaders, women groups and leaders of other organizations under the theme“Equipping God’s people for transformation leadership”. African traditional religion, the role of the church in society, leadership and teamwork and worldview and development are some of the topics being discussed at the conference.
